What is cologne?
Have you ever wondered what cologne really is and from where it originates? There is a place in Germany called, Cologne. This is where cologne originated.
Is it made up of cookies and spice and everything nice? Well, it is made of wonderful things that everyone knows about like lemon, orange, tangerine, lime, grapefruit, along with bergamot and neroli all in a foundation of dilute ethanol. Yes, there is more. Cologne can also have essential oils included like thyme oil, rosemary oil, orange leaf oil (petit-grain) which actually is making me hungry.
You might also find a couple of my most favorite flowers like lavender oil or jasmine oil. Now you're talking. Now that makes me want to run to the cabinet and apply some of my favorite cologne. But wait, just like everything else in life, there is a proper way to apply your cologne. Are you applying it correctly?
Wear it, love it, but please, apply it correctly!
*First of all, how the bottle is spraying makes a difference. If you have had it for a long time or just bought it and it has been sitting on a store shelf for a period of time, it may not be spraying correctly. Give it a couple test squirts. Better in the air than on you!
*Second, give your inside wrist (either one) just one short spray.
*Third, rub your wrists together. You have seen this done. This will spread the cologne evenly on both wrists. I always do this but didn't know why.
*Fourth, one short pump of the spray to your hands or fingers tips and then apply that behind your ears, your chest and on the side of your neck. You know, where there is a pulse. You want that neck kissable, right?
That's it. That wasn't so hard.
Some bottles don't have a spray top.
So my cologne bottle does not have a spray top. Now what? Bath time? No, no. Put your finger over the open bottle top and turn the cologne bottle upside down. A little dab will do you here. Now do like you did with the spray. Apply to the inside of your wrists, on the chest, behind the ears and the side of your neck. You know, all the pulse spots.
That's it. That is all you need. No spraying of clothing or swabbing places that may burn. Remember the old saying, less is more.
Here are a couple little things you should know.
*When you are applying your cologne, don't rub. Gentle pats are all you need. If you rub you will make the natural oils of your skin alter the cologne.
*Like we have already said, don't get your clothes in the way of your cologne. Although cologne does wonderful things for you, it may not be wonderful for your clothing and could ruin them. Not good!
How to buy cologne.
Just like when you apply your cologne at home, in the store spray a little on the inside of your wrist. Now, wait just a few seconds before you sniff. Let it breathe and get use to your body chemistry. Now smell it and if you like it, it's a good choice to purchase.
